Which outcome will soon limit sustained Deuterium-Tritium (D-T) fusion within present-generation Tokamak reactors?

A)Neutron activation of the reactor walls
B)Inadequate magnetic confinement pressures
C)Insufficient plasma-heating capabilities
D)Instability of the fueling process

💡 Explanation

Neutron activation limits Tokamak duration because the D-T fusion produces high-energy neutrons. Neutron bombardment transmutes and weakens structural material via neutron activation, therefore causing embrittlement, radioactivity in containment, rather than pressure or heating limitations, because those can be improved.
